power windows on '98 aurora
I have a '98 aurora. None of the window controls will work. I replaced the breaker under the back seat, but still no power. Does anyone know if there is another fuse somewhere or some other control box? I'm not able to locate anything in the owners manual.

slhouse, welcome to the forums. It may be the actual wiring harness from the drivers door back into the car body. These cars were built with wire that was too thin of a guage in this area. The constant opening & closing of the drivers door will eventually wear down the wire and cause a short or open circuit. This is the first area I would look at if I ever had any trouble with any components controlled by switches on the drivers door such as power windows, seats, courtesy lamps, etc.
